INVESTMENT OPPORTUNITY: High demand location in the Heart of the Finger Lakes, and home to Cornell University and Ithaca College. This Iconic four story building, in a prominent commercial corridor, “Restaurant Row”, and Gateway to the famous Ithaca Commons is looking for new ownership for the first time in many years. With over 12,000 SF, it was redesigned by architect Jason Demarest and under-went comprehensive renovations in 2016. This investment opportunity includes long term quality tenant Simeons Restaurant and offers elevator service to five, bright and spacious, 1 - bedroom and 1 - bedroom plus den apartments with high quality finishes. Ideal for investors aiming to capitalize on Ithaca's vibrant market, ensuring continuous demand and significant growth potential.
